I decided on making my very own noodles for this recipe, however when you resolve that’s a bit of a problem, decide up some ramen noodles if you discover any. If you can’t, a tip I saw online is shopping for some thick spaghetti noodles and throwing in some baking soda within the cooking water. It ought to give it the alkaline to the noodles so it extra intently resembles ramen noodles. Making ramen noodles involves mixing flour with water and carbonated water to kind a dough, stretching it out thinly, then cutting it into noodles. Noodle high quality varies based on the kind of flour used, how rapidly the water is added, how thick the dough is, how thick and the way it is sliced, and how old the noodles are. Tonkotsu ramen makes use of a rich, savory, cloudy broth made with pork bones and other elements and is commonly cooked for a quantity of hours earlier than being combined with noodles and slices of pork. Shoyu ramen has a clear broth flavored with soy sauce and different elements that’s lighter and never as wealthy as tonkotsu. Chicken, pork, and even fish broths can function the bottom.

If you’re acquainted with miso soup, you would possibly already have an idea of the kind of flavor that miso paste can convey to your ramen. Ditch the packaged seasoning and add a couple of tablespoons of miso paste to your boiling water.

Regular ramen noodles are made of 30 to 35 p.c of water addition. You use 1000 grams of flour and 300 grams of  water to make ramen noodles.
